Transaction 8ff85d4f626147874a12cfa5324a61a2d35c395119c571860099ea719f2f08ed
1 Input
1 Output
-
8ff85d4f626147874a12cfa5324a61a2d35c395119c571860099ea719f2f08ed:0
- value
- 2449506
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1dd174907a57b4fb8f75e0a9bab5bc21a18838d2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13ifWmvU8RTvCuPajcc1YxHQcmXtWXQ3wr